I have a White's MXT with a stock 9.5" coil. We've had a love/hate relationship over the years, but I've grown accustomed to her, I suppose. There is a place that I have hunted over the years, an old church yard way out in the woods. You've got to know it is there to find it.

Anyway, it was abandoned as a church about 100 years ago and now is maintained by the cemetery committee and the 'homecoming' group - an annual reunion picnic is held every year. I've found silver dimes, buffalo nickels, wheat and indian head pennies, etc. But the area around the picnic tables each about 30" long) is lousy with pull tabs and bottle caps. I figure if I had a smaller coil, it would help me find the 'gooder' stuff in-between the aluminum trash.

So my question for you folks with experience with such is - of the smaller coils available for the MXT, which is the best for this type of hunting? BTW - I've recently purchased a Deus with an 11" coil, but it and I are not yet speaking the same language, and I'm not sure it will do as good a job in the environment I described as the MXT with a smaller coil.

I love the SEF 8x6 over the stock 10inch DD its just as deep... its great in heavy iron.
 
Don't have an MXT but I use the 6" concentric on my IDX.
Great coil in the trashy spots.
Think it's called a 5.3 for the mxt version.

I have found few coils as good as the Bullseye 5.3 on my IDX as well...I think you need the “V-rated” version for the MXT. I have an Explorer,I have a CTX...but you will NEVER pry the 5.3 and the IDX out of my hands.
 
The SEF 6" or White's 4x6. I didn't like the 5.3 coil, something about the design wouldn't let you get very close to fences, the SEF 6" is a lot better.

You should not need a V rated coil, the MXT was out before the V3 was released.
